VoIP remains one of the hottest topics in the telecommunications and business phone system world. VoIP (Voice over IP) phone numbers are virtual phone numbers that use Internet Protocol (IP) technology to make and receive voice calls.
The main attraction of VoIP is the technology can work on regular Internet connections and can be used to make and receive low-cost calls. VoIP phone numbers used for business typically come with a number of features and options. VoIP phone number helps the businesses to receive and make voice calls over the Internet. To conduct VoIP calls, a platform such as VoIP software or hardware is required to take telephone calls from conventional telephone lines and convert them into a digital signal that can be transferred over the Internet. Business owners don’t have to spend thousands of dollars on building a physical infrastructure for installing a VoIP system. The VoIP number comes from a distant carrier, therefore, there is no need for an individual to have a physical setup in their territory.
Why Use a VoIP Phone Number for Business?
Businesses can reap numerous benefits from using a VoIP phone number. There are several advantages of using VoIP technology for business applications, including:
- Cost savings: VoIP is comparatively much cheaper than the traditional landlines. Businesses that are running on lean budgets will benefit substantially by switching to VoIP phone numbers. Most carriers also provide a variety of pricing plans and packages that offer different levels of services.
- Portability: Most VoIP services are very portable, allowing for easy changing of locations. This enables businesses to stay connected to customers even when they are on the move.
- Scalability: VoIP services can be easily and quickly scaled to meet a growing business’s needs without any costly upgrades or infrastructure changes.
Features of a VoIP Phone Number for Business
VoIP phone numbers for business come with a variety of features, such as:
- Call forwarding: VoIP allows callers to be forwarded to another VoIP number or a conventional telephone or mobile phone. VoIP services also allow to forward a call to a voice mail box, in which the caller can leave a voice message.
- Call queuing: Call queues enable the incoming calls to be held in a queue and connected to customer service representatives when they become available. This allows businesses to handle large volumes of incoming calls without losing customer service quality.
- Voice mail: VoIP services usually include a voice mail box and the ability to review and playback messages via the web, phone, or email message.
- Auto attendant: Auto attendants allow customers to access recorded information and select the right department or personnel to answer their questions.
- Video and audio conferencing: VoIP services allow businesses to hold video or audio conferences with multiple participants either through the cloud or with in-house software and hardware.
